The joints between the individual mosaic pieces are clearly visible on the Ankabut Blue Green bistro table . This is entirely intentional, as the craftsmen had the artistically woven web of a spider (Ankabut) in mind when designing it. Alternatively, the design is reminiscent of fireworks unfolding magnificently in the sky. The diamond-shaped border is typical of Oriental mosaic art: this religious symbol is believed to have a protective function.
This mosaic table clearly shows how well green and blue tones harmonize. Together with a few brown and white accents, the mosaic artist composed the Ankabut pattern from tesserae (mosaic stones) in light and dark blue, emerald green, and turquoise. The position of the brown cellije stars creates the impression of looking into the calyxes of densely growing flowers. The mosaic invites you to explore its diversity.
